How can I get time with a writing consultant?
The Writing Center is strictly appointment-based. You can make an appointment by visiting our appointment website. We offer both in-person and online help with writing.
Who's eligible to visit the Writing Center?

Does it cost anything to see a writing consultant?
No. Writing consultations at the Writing Center are provided at no cost.
How can the Writing Center help me?
The Writing Center is the place where you can get the help you need with almost any writing issue, from brainstorming your paper, project, or presentation, revising your work, to polishing a final essay. Do you need help getting started? Do you find yourself stumped on what to do? Need help with citing sources? Grammar? Bring your ideas and/or writing to the Writing Center for help.
What can I expect a consultant to do?
The Writing Center will help you identify the purpose of your writing, assess how it fits the assignment, give you feedback on your writing's effectiveness, and offer advice and ideas to help you create and revise.
Will a consultant proofread and/or copy edit my paper?
No. But consultants can teach you how to identify grammatical and usage errors, lead you to helpful information and resources, and help you learn how to make corrections. Since part of learning how to proofread well is learning how to spot your own errors, you should expect consultants to leave some for you to identify on your own. They won't necessarily mark every error in your work nor correct them for you.
